Output 84169c7198da5e17d51e54ee00f9f08cf5e98e23c8ae375a540c360b0d72fa49:91

value
135080
script pubkey
OP_0 OP_PUSHBYTES_20 ec72f81e37516c396cd5c7b6ee885fdf84315e47
address
bc1qa3e0s83h29krjmx4c7mwazzlm7zrzhj86k6ard
transaction
84169c7198da5e17d51e54ee00f9f08cf5e98e23c8ae375a540c360b0d72fa49
confirmations
135582
spent
true